Output f63dd4f658e007d6f0f2919d6ef59c7e6723fba45d3856afaf68c8f028482672:1

value
503928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66698203d7c8275a84b29fdf33b4264de51f7d91 OP_EQUAL
address
3B2XEverGb6YcSL7QVAQr7yeGxXrJT2WQ7
transaction
f63dd4f658e007d6f0f2919d6ef59c7e6723fba45d3856afaf68c8f028482672
spent
true